The Role of Leisure Attitude and Flow Experience: A Model of Serious Leisure and Leisure Benefits among Cyclists
碩士 === 國立澎湖科技大學 === 觀光休閒事業管理研究所 === 98 === The purpose of this study was to construct a causal model in an effort to explore the relationship between serious leisure and leisure benefits by considering the role of leisure attitude and flow experience of cyclists. Data were collected from members...
